I managed to pick up an OEM BMW head unit for peanuts a few months ago. Although it looked great having used it a few times I wasn't getting along with it mainly due to the poor sound quality, so it was sold on eBay.
20181213_182713.jpg


and instead I got this which looks good and sounds awesome, although it is on the dear side slightly.

Alpine CDE-205DAB, it has bluetooth, CD, DAB, USB and aux (basically all connectivity you could want) and the display can be set to match the rest of the centre console.

I fitted a JVC head unit, its retro looking and has a colour pallet so you can match the orange, also DAB, with aux and USB as well as bluetooth, fitted 4x 5.25" Vibe Slicks, sounds brilliant

My Wife bought me a new radio for Christmas, DAB Kenwood bt504DAB from H*lfords. Good DAB sounds and excellent hands free phone. Multi choice colour display, with a bit of adjustment can be set to match the BMW amber/red illumination.
